Victor LaForest Lewis

September 21, 1922 — January 7, 2013

Victor LaForest Lewis, 90, of Red Wing, died Monday, Jan. 7, 2013, at his home. He was born on September 21, 1922 in Hayfield, Minnesota to Lucius and Ella (Johnson) Lewis. He grew up in Hayfield graduating from Hayfield High School. He enlisted in the US Army Air Corps and served during World War II. He was stationed at Normandy, France, Ardennes, Rhineland and Central Europe. On July 16, 1943 he married Bettie Cottner in Winfield, Kansas. Following his discharge, he worked for Chicago Great Western Railroad until his retirement at the age of 61. He was a member of First Presbyterian Church for over 50 years, the Leo C. Peterson American Legion Post #54 and the Red Wing Elks BPOE #845. He was a history buff and an avid reader. He enjoyed golfing, fishing, biking and playing cards. His family recalls his great sense of humor and how much he enjoyed spending time with them. In May of 2009, he had the opportunity to take the Honor Flight to Washington DC with his daughter, Jackie.
